Exports In 2022, Bosnia and Herzegovina exported $6.27M in Cheese, making it the 75th largest exporter of Cheese in the world. At the same year, Cheese was the 187th most exported product in Bosnia and Herzegovina. The main destination of Cheese exports from Bosnia and Herzegovina are: Croatia ($3.52M), Montenegro ($1.07M), Serbia ($675k), Saudi Arabia ($194k), and Germany ($184k).
The fastest growing export markets for Cheese of Bosnia and Herzegovina between 2021 and 2022 were Croatia ($477k), Serbia ($114k), and Netherlands ($55.9k).
Imports In 2022, Bosnia and Herzegovina imported $61.2M in Cheese, becoming the 70th largest importer of Cheese in the world. At the same year, Cheese was the 56th most imported product in Bosnia and Herzegovina. Bosnia and Herzegovina imports Cheese primarily from: Germany ($34.6M), Croatia ($8.73M), Slovenia ($7.04M), Serbia ($3.15M), and Austria ($2.19M).
The fastest growing import markets in Cheese for Bosnia and Herzegovina between 2021 and 2022 were Germany ($3.9M), Slovenia ($784k), and Austria ($347k).
